Frequently Asked Questions About Aircond Service

July 15, 2022 by Jeremy Lindy

Aircond service is an important part of keeping your home or office comfortable. If you are considering having your air conditioner serviced, you may have some questions about the process. To help you make the best decision for your needs, we have answered some of the most frequently asked questions about aircond service.

What's The Cost To Service an Aircond?

One of the most frequently asked questions we get here at Aircond Service headquarters is, “What’s the cost to service an aircond?”. The first thing you need to know is that there is no one-size-fits-all answer to this question. The cost of servicing an aircond will vary depending on the type and model of aircond, as well as the company you choose to do the work.

With that said, there are a few general factors that will affect the cost of aircond services. These include the frequency of service, the number of units being serviced, and the location of the units.

As for the number of units being serviced, this will obviously have an impact on the overall cost. Servicing multiple units will typically cost more than servicing just one.

Besides that, your location can also affect the cost of aircond services. This is because servicing airconds in remote areas or rural locations can sometimes be more expensive due to the increased travel time and costs associated with getting to and from these locations.

How Often Should I Service My Aircond?

Aircond servicing is important to ensure that your aircond is running efficiently and effectively. Depending on the type of aircond you have, the frequency of servicing may vary. For example,window airconds should be serviced at least once a year, while split-type airconds can go longer between services.

In general, it is best to check your aircond's owner's manual for specific recommendations. In addition, it is important to keep an eye on your aircond unit for signs that it needs servicing, such as unusual noises or decreased performance. 

If you notice any of these problems, be sure to contact a specialist to service aircond as soon as possible. This will help to prevent further damage and keep your aircond unit running smoothly.

What's included in an Aircond Service?

Most aircond services will include a thorough cleaning of the unit, both inside and out. This may include removing the cover and using a brush or vacuum to remove any dirt, dust, or debris that has built up on the coils. The technician will also check the refrigerant levels and top off the unit if necessary.

In addition, they will inspect the ductwork and airflow to ensure that there are no blockages or leaks. Finally, they will test the unit to ensure that it is functioning properly before leaving. If you have any questions about what is included in your aircond service, be sure to ask the technician when they arrive.

What Are The Benefits of Aircond Service?

Aircond service is important to keeping your air conditioner running smoothly and efficiently. Just like any other mechanical system, air conditioners need regular maintenance to function properly. By serviced air conditioners, you can extend its lifespan, improve its performance, and avoid costly repairs. With proper aircond servicing, you can also enjoy cleaner and healthier air inside your home. Contrary to popular belief, regular aircond servicing does not just clean the unit itself but also helps to improve indoor air quality.

This is because service technicians are trained to identify and fix potential problems that could lead to indoor air pollution. Overall, there are many benefits of having your air conditioner serviced regularly by a professional. Not only will it keep your unit running smoothly and efficiently, but it will also help improve the quality of the air in your home.

Conclusion

As you can see, there are many benefits to having your aircond serviced regularly. Not only will it help to extend the lifespan of your unit, but it will also improve its performance and efficiency. In addition, regular servicing can also help to improve indoor air quality by identifying and fixing potential problems that could lead to pollution. 

If you have an air conditioner, be sure to have it serviced by a qualified technician at least once a year. This will help to keep your unit running smoothly and prevent costly repairs down the road.
